首頁 > 範文 > 實習報告 / 正文
相信大家都知道,實踐是打開理論寶庫的鑰匙,但凡是在我們的學習工作中。都需要寫報告,一份優質的報告是我們能力的有效證明。今天小編為您提供大學生計算機專業實習報告,如果對這個話題感興趣的話,請關注本站!
大學生計算機專業實習報告【篇1】
一、嵌入式系統開發與應用概述
在今日,嵌入式ARM 技術已經成為了一門比較熱門的學科,無論是在電子類的什么領域,你都可以看到嵌入式ARM 的影子。如果你還停留在單片機級別的學習,那么實際上你已經落下時代腳步了,ARM 嵌入式技術正以幾何的倍數高速發展,它幾乎滲透到了幾乎你所想到的領域。本章節就是將你領入ARM 的學習大門,開始嵌入式開發之旅。以嵌入式計算機為技術核心的嵌入式系統是繼網絡技術之后,又一個IT領域新的技術發展方向。由于嵌入式系統具有體積小、性能強、功耗低、可靠性高以及面向行業具體應用等突出特征, 目前已經廣泛地應用于軍事國防、消費電子、信息家電、網絡通信、工業控制等各個領域。嵌入式的廣泛應用可以說是無所不在。
嵌入式微處理器技術的基礎是通用計算機技術。現在許多嵌入式處理器也是從早期的PC 機的應用發展演化過來的,如早期PC 諸如TRS-80、Apple II 和所用的Z80 和6502 處理器,至今仍為低 端的嵌入式應用。在應用中,嵌入式微處理器具有體積小、重量輕、成本低、可靠性高的優點。嵌入式處理器目前主要有Am186/88、386EX、SC-400、Power PC、68000、MIPS、ARM 等系列。
在早期實際的嵌入式應用中,芯片選擇時往往以某一種微處理器內核為核心,在芯片內部集成必要的ROM/EPROM/Flash/EEPROM、SRAM、接口總線及總線控制邏輯、定時/計數器、WatchDog、I/O、串行口、脈寬調制輸出、A/D、D/A 等各種必要的功能和外設。
二、實習設備
硬件:Embest EduKit-IV實驗平臺、ULINK2仿真器套件、PC機
軟件:μVision IDE for ARM集成開發環境、Windows 98/20xx/NT/XP
三、實習目的
1.初步掌握液晶屏的使用及其電路設計方法;掌握S3C2410X處理器的LCD控制器的使用;掌握通過任務調用的方法把液晶顯示函數添加到uC/OS-II中;通過實驗掌握液晶顯示文本及圖形的方法與程序設計。
2.了解S3C2410X處理器UART相關控制寄存器的使用; 熟悉ARM處理器系統硬件電路中UART接口的設計方法:掌握ARM處理器串行通信的軟件編程方法。
3.掌握有關音頻處理的基礎知識;通過實驗了解IIS音頻接口的工作原理;通過實驗掌握對處理器S3C2410X中IIS模塊電路的控制方法;通過實驗掌握對常用IIS接口音頻芯片的控制方法。
4.了解μC/OS-II移植條件和內核基本結構;掌握將μC/OS-II內核移植到ARM9處理器上的方法和步驟。
四、實習要求
通過對μC/OS-II移植實驗、μC/OS-II LCD顯示實驗、串口通信實驗、IIS音頻實驗、液晶顯示實驗的學習,并將各部分內容合并,最終得出實習結果,實習要求在鍵盤上輸入學號,在液晶顯示屏上顯示相應的學生信息。學生信息包括顯示每個人的照片和姓名系別等,并用鍵控設置學生輸出的順序,輸入學號就顯示那個學生的信息,然后過一段時間就順序循環播放。
移植μC/OS-II內核到ARM處理器S3C2410,在IDE中觀察其運行狀況編寫S3C2410X處理器的串口通信程序;監視串行口UART1動作;將從UART1接收到的字符串回送顯示。將從UART1接收到的字符串回送顯示。
通過使用Embest EduKit-IV實驗板的彩色液晶屏(800*480)進行電路設計,掌握液晶屏作為人機接口界面的設計方法,并編寫任務函數在uC/OS-II系統中實現位圖顯示。在uC/OS-II中建立五個任務Tast1和Tast2,其中Tast1順序熄滅四個LED,延遲一會在順序點亮四個LED。Tast2在LCD屏幕上循環顯示三幅圖片,并打印一些文字信息和背景音樂。過使用Embest EduKit-III實驗板的256 色彩色液晶屏(320x240)進行電路設計,掌握液晶屏作為人機接口界面的設計方法,并編寫程序實現:畫出多個矩形框;顯示ASCII字符;顯示漢字字符;顯示彩色位圖。
五、實習步驟
1. 準備實驗環境
使用ULINK2仿真器連接Embest EduKit-IV實驗平臺的主板JTAG接口;使用Embest EduKit-IV實驗平臺附帶的交叉串口線,連接實驗平臺主板上的COM2和PC機的串口(一般PC只有一個串口,如果有多個請自行選擇,筆記本沒有串口設備的可購買USB轉串口適配器擴充);使用Embest EduKit-IV實驗平臺附帶的電源適配器,連接實驗平臺主板上的電源接口。
2. 串口接收設置
在PC機上運行windows自帶的超級終端串口通信程序,或者使用實驗平臺附帶光盤內設置好了的超級終端,設置超級終端:波特率115200、1位停止位、無校驗位、無硬件流控制,或者使用其它串口通信程序。(注:超級終端串口的選擇根據用戶的PC串口硬件不同,請自行選擇,如果PC機只有一個串口,一般是COM1)
3. 打開實驗例程
1)打開實驗程序
2)運行μVision IDE for ARM軟件
3)默認打開的工程在源碼編輯窗口會顯示實驗例程的說明文件readme.txt,詳細閱讀并理解實驗內容。
4)工程提供了兩種運行方式:一是下載到SDRAM中調試運行,二是固化到Nor Flash中運行。用戶可以在工具欄Select Target下拉框中選擇在RAM中調試運行還是固化Flash中運行。下面實驗將介紹下載到SDRAM中調試運行,所以我們在Select Target下拉框中選擇UART_Test IN RAM。
5)接下來開始編譯鏈接工程,在菜單欄“Projiet”選擇“Build target”或者“Rebuild all target files”編譯整個工程。
6編譯完成后,在輸出窗口可以看到編譯提示信息,比如“".SDRAMUART_Test.axf" - 0 Error(s), 1 Warning(s).”,如果顯示“0 Error(s)”即表示編譯成功。
7)撥動實驗平臺電源開關,給實驗平臺上電,單擊菜單欄Debug->Start/Stop Debug Session項將編譯出來的映像文件下載到SDRAM中,或者單擊工具欄“”按鈕來下載。
8)下載完成后,單擊菜單欄Debug->Run項運行程序,或者單擊工具欄“”按鈕來全速運行程序。用戶也可以使用進行單步調試程序。
精品小說推薦: 昔日落魄少年被逐出家族,福禍相依得神秘老者相助,從此人生路上一片青雲! 我行我瀟灑,彰顯我性格! 彆罵小爺拽,媳婦多了用車載! 妹紙一聲好歐巴,轉手就是摸摸大! “不要嘛!” 完整內容請點擊辣手仙醫- 上一篇:計算機學生實習報告精選6篇
- 下一篇:計算機專業實習報告精選8篇
猜你喜歡
- 2024-05-13 2024年大學生個人優秀實習報告精選
- 2024-04-26 客服頂崗實習報告(通用5篇)
- 2024-04-26 簡短創意元旦幽默祝福語元旦賀卡祝福語100句以上
- 2024-04-26 銷售實習報告自我總結3000字
- 2024-04-26 大學生文員實習報告5篇
- 2024-04-26 蘇州古典園林實習總結報告
- 2024-04-26 大學生個人實習報告5篇范文
- 2024-04-26 工程人員實習報告10篇
- 2024-04-26 行政部辦公室文秘實習報告
- 2024-04-26 銀行工作實習報告10篇
- 標簽列表
-
- 支付寶 (21238)
- 工作總結 (5796)
- 小學六年級 (5547)
- 小學五年級 (5464)
- 原神 (4737)
- 英雄聯盟 (4408)
- 初中初一 (4092)
- 魔獸世界 (3871)
- 祝福語 (3841)
- 博德之門3(Baldur&039s Gate 3) (3802)
- 暗黑破壞神4 (3797)
- 我的世界(Minecraft) (3716)
- 小學四年級 (3710)
- 博德之門3 (3320)
- 小學三年級 (3320)
- 名著讀后感 (3235)
- 讀后感 (3170)
- 暗黑破壞神4(Diablo 4) (2816)
- 高考滿分作文 (2762)
- 大俠立志傳(Hero&039s Adventure) (2742)
- 讀書心得范文 (2703)
- 艾爾登法環 (2671)
- 地下城與勇士 (2639)
- 泰拉瑞亞(Terraria) (2628)
- 艾爾登法環(Elden Ring) (2623)
- 塞爾達傳說:王國之淚(The Legend of Zelda: Tears of Kingdom) (2463)
- 命運方舟 (2443)
- 塞爾達傳說:王國之淚 (2419)
- 500字 (2409)
- 550字 (2369)
- 幻獸帕魯 (2303)
- 小學一年級 (2297)
- 450字 (2272)
- 400字 (2259)
- 小學二年級 (2256)
- 年終工作總結 (2182)
- 600字 (2155)
- 讀后感600字 (2138)
- 800字 (2009)
- 高考 (2006)